| In this episode Nog returns to the station
after spending time at a Starfleet Medical facility. In the episode
"The Siege of AR-558" Ensign Nog lost his leg while in battle with the
Jem'Hadar. Despite all medical reason, Ensign Nog felt pain when
using his artificial leg, however the doctors determined that the pain
was mental. Nog was forced to limp with a cane to avoid the pain.
But his pain was much deeper. After the crew of the station tried
to reach out to Nog, he ran away and hid in the holosuite program of Vic
Fontaine. Over time, Nog became so involved in the program that he
forgot about real life. In the end, Nog revealed to Vic Fontaine
that the pain in his leg was the personification of the fear he had for
his life. Nog had seen many die and he feared that if he could loose
his leg, then he could just as easily die. After letting this out,
Nog found the courage to leave the holosuite and return to duty.
As reward for Vic's help, Nog talked Quark into leaving Vic Fontaine's
program running 26 hours a day, because thoughout the course of his stay
in the holosuite, Nog discovered that Vic Fontaine had no life. But
now, with the holosuite on all day, Vic had a life.
